BES-2006: Second Wave of the Study on the Brazilian Electoral System

Abstract
BES-2006, the second wave of post-electoral research of an academic nature held in Brazil, was inserted in Module 3 (2006-2010) of the Comparative Study of Electoral Systems (CSES) of the University of Michigan, whose central concern was to analyze the scope of the electoral system from the perspective of voters over their choices, the retrospective assessment of parties, candidates, and ideologies. The questions in this module intend to answer specifically how voters distinguish parties, and how contextual conditions increase the degree and convenience with which they can make these distinctions and their relative importance in different contexts. Some results of the BES-2006 are presented in Public Opinion Journal, vol. 13, n. 2 (Oct. 2007).
